This cache is part of the CoPaTo (County Parks Tour) series of caches located in the York County Park System. There will be one cache from this series in each of eight county parks and each cache will have some sort of clue that leads to an event cache to be held September 23rd, 2006. The location of the event will be kept secret, the only way to attend the event is to log each of the caches and collect the clues that lead to the event. The parks are each aware of the caches and have given approval for them to remain in their prospective locations as permanent caches.
This is a 750 acre park. Rocky Ridge was acquired in 1968, making it the first county park. There are over 12 miles of trails for hikers, bikers and horseback riding. Enjoy a walk on the trail!
